Auhtorization like any corporate authority is made by the taxpayer in their own method of bestowing powers on Corporate Officers. As far as the IRS is concerned, the return must be signed by a Corporate Officer, or anyone that is authorized to do so, by having an appropriate form on file (which requires certain proofs). In reality, especially in todays world requiring electronic filing by most Corps...and that requires several types of Corporate authorization, this may not be terribly important as the signature/authorization on the check (or electronic payment) for paying the taxes certainly proves corporate intent.

Q: Who is authorised to sign companies Income Tax Return?

Signatures for a minor child who files a tax return?

Minor children should sign their own tax return. If a child cannot sign his or her return, a parent or guardian can sign the child's name in the space provided at the bottom of the tax return followed by "By (signature), parent (or guardian) for minor child."

What happens if you don't file an income-tax return?

If you do not file an income tax return the IRS will send a request for it (assuming that they had enough income reported to them to believe that you were required to file one).If you still don't file one, usually within a few years, the IRS is authorized under Section 6020(b) to file a return on your behalf based upon the information that was reported to them. This is called a "Substitute for Return" in IRS lingo. Once they file that return, one of two things will happen:If they show that you were due a refund, they will stop the process (they will not voluntarily send you a refund if you did not go to the trouble of preparing a return).If you owe money, they will assess it and begin collection action against you.Of course, the IRS can only prepare a tax return based upon income that is reported to them. This means that if you do not have income reported to you via a W-2 or 1099, they likely have no idea what kind of money you are or are not earning.If you are in such a situation, it is possible that you can go years and years (or forever) without filing a return and, because the IRS doesn't have any information about your income, they will never prepare a return for you.
